Dennis Erectus

Dennis Erectus started talking again. He was one of the night shift DJs on KOME. Whenever I heard his voice, my ears would perk up. I didn't want to miss anything he said. I was becoming more and more intrigued with this guy. He was funny, sarcastic and at times sounded like a madman.
Sometimes he would purposely start playing a crappy bubble gum pop song that you knew he hated. Like the time when he played “Shake Your Booty” by KC and the Sunshine Band. Then after about a minute, he would start screaming and moving the needle to make scratching noises. Then he would play it super fast. Then he would slow it down to half speed. And then the next thing you'd hear, would be him screaming and smashing the record to bits. I always had to laugh at this. But it was therapeutic in a way. Whenever he was on air, my ears were glued to the radio, waiting to hear what he would do next. He also played a lot of good metal, which of course was awesome.
Another thing about Dennis was that he liked to insult his listeners. But we didn’t get offended. It was just part of the act and it was usually pretty funny. He liked to claim that we lacked any class or sophistication. He would also do skits sometimes like “Dear Dennis” which was kind of like the life advice column, “Dear Abby”. But “Dear Dennis” was hilarious. His advice would be totally demented.
One other skit he did that was funny was “President Erectus”. This was where he would talk about all the things he would do if he were president. It was pretty perverted but it was hard not to laugh at some of the crazy stuff he said.
